Wild For To Hold

by Annabel Murray

Willful, tomboyish Shari Freeman, as untamed as the countryside she was raised in, had only one love, and that was Threlkeld, the family's isolated Lake District farm. But hard times were forcing her and her grandmother to sell their country haven. And though Shari was resigned to this reality, she naturally resisted warming up to any prospective buyer. But Griff Masterson sparked entirely unexpected responses in Shari. Her tranquil valley life would never be the same—and neither would she.
